What Do Real Estate Videography Services in Kenya Include?
A professional property video production in Kenya covers far more than a phone walkthrough:
- Cinematic walkthrough tours — stabilised, room-by-room films that follow the natural flow of the home, shot with wide lenses and colour-graded so spaces read bright, true and generous
- Drone aerials — the establishing shots that sell location: compound size, neighbourhood context, distance to the highway, the view from the fourth floor. For aerial stills to match, see our real estate drone photography in Kenya service
- Agent-hosted tours — you on camera, walking buyers through the property; the format that builds an agent’s personal brand fastest
- Vertical reels — 15–60 second cuts sized for TikTok, Instagram and WhatsApp status, where Kenyan property marketing actually happens now
- Off-plan and development films — show-house tours, progress updates and amenity showcases that keep off-plan buyers confident between deposit and handover
- Voice-over and captions — professional narration or on-screen specs (bedrooms, size, price, location) so the video sells even on mute
Real Estate Videography Service Prices in Kenya
Published rates, because agents and developers budget per listing:
- Standard walkthrough tour — KSh 25,000 to 40,000. A 2–3 minute stabilised ground tour of one property, colour-graded with licensed music and on-screen captions, plus one vertical reel cut from the same footage. Delivered within 5 business days.
- Cinematic property film with drone — KSh 50,000 to 80,000. Everything above plus aerial coverage, agent or narrator on camera, twilight exterior shots where the property warrants them, and three vertical reels for social campaigns.
- Development & off-plan marketing package — from KSh 120,000. Multi-unit coverage for developers: master film for the project, individual unit tours, amenity showcases, drone progress footage, and a reels bundle for the sales team’s social calendars. Quoted per project.
- Agent retainers — for agencies listing weekly, monthly packages bring the per-property cost down sharply and guarantee turnaround. Ask for retainer rates.
Every package includes full usage rights across portals, social media and paid advertising — request an exact quote with your property’s location and size.
Video Tour or Virtual Tour? Real Estate Videography Services in Kenya
Buyers and agents often conflate the two. A video tour is a produced film — directed, edited, emotional; it markets the property and works everywhere from YouTube to WhatsApp. A 360° virtual tour is an interactive walkthrough buyers control themselves — excellent for due diligence, weaker at generating desire, and it can’t be posted as a reel. Our honest guidance: video sells the viewing; virtual tours support the serious buyer afterwards. For most Kenyan listings, a cinematic video tour is the higher-return first investment, and premium listings benefit from both.

Where Your Property Video Should Run
A tour that sits unwatched sells nothing, so every delivery is formatted for the places Kenyan buyers actually look:
- Property portals — BuyRentKenya, Property24 and Property254 listings with video consistently outperform photo-only listings in inquiries
- YouTube — the searchable archive; diaspora buyers hunting “2 bedroom apartment Westlands” find and share full tours here
- TikTok & Instagram Reels — where Kenyan property discovery happens now; our vertical cuts are built for the first three seconds that decide a scroll
- WhatsApp — the closing channel. Agents send the tour directly to serious buyers and into buyer groups; we compress a WhatsApp-friendly version so it forwards without quality loss
- Facebook property groups — still where a huge share of private Kenyan sales begin
How a Property Video Shoot Works- Real Estate Videography Services in Kenya
1. Brief — location, property size, target buyer and where the video will run.
2. Prep guidance — we send a simple staging checklist (lights on, surfaces clear, curtains open) that makes every property film dramatically better.
3. The shoot — typically 2–4 hours per property: stabilised interiors, exteriors, drone passes and agent segments, timed for the best natural light.
4. Delivery — the edited tour plus reels within 5 business days via private gallery, in every resolution and aspect ratio your platforms need.
